Arbitration Victory
Gass Turek attorneys David Turek and Rachel Potter, with the assistance of paralegal Joy Gravunder, recently secured a $4 million arbitration award for a client seeking contractual indemnification from a foreign supplier. The supplier was responsible for misassembling a product that injured a plaintiff in Alabama. Gass Turek’s client was forced to resolve the suit in Alabama and then pursue indemnification from the vendor. After a three-day hearing, with unusual scheduling to address a 13-hour time difference between the parties’ key witnesses, the arbitrator ultimately awarded our client 100% of its requested damages, along with attorneys’ fees and prejudgment interest. With the award, our client will be made completely whole for its losses stemming from the Alabama product liability case.
